I was blessed to have been the first author on Children and the Media when the Canadian Pediatric Society published its first paper on children and media. There is only one problem….at that timeĀ  there were no smart phones. Now there are.

It means a parent has a choice. Let you child as young as one year use it…or not

My advice is plain and simple: do not let a child that young use a smart phone.

Three reasons for this:

—read a book instead. The return on investment is higher

—Go outside. Fresh air is one of those things we can never get too much of

—It may affect his or her sleep.
